Mr. Sri Gauri Shankar Gupta, APP Mr. Jainendra Kumar, Advocate 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E SUNIL DUTTA MISHRA ORAL ORDER 25-11-2025 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ner, learned counsel for O.P. No. 2 and learned A.P.P. for the State.
2. The present Criminal Miscellaneous petition has been filed for cancellation of anticipatory bail granted to O.P. No. 2, vide order dated 08.04.2011 passed by this Hon'ble Court in Cr. Misc. No. 11400 of 2011 in connection with Goh P.S. Case No. 103 of 2010.
3. Learned counsels for the parties submit that both the parties have compromised and accordingly, this case may be disposed of.
4. Learned A.P.P. for the State has no objection to this prayer.
Patna High Court CR. MISC. No.54836 of 2017(11) dt.25-11-2025 2/2
5. In view of the submission of learned counsels for the parties, this case is disposed of.
